/* CSS Document */


/*首页公司简介*/
#about{width:1140px; height:320px;overflow:hidden; background:#fff; margin:auto;}
#about img{}
#about .left{width:370px; overflow:hidden; float:left;}
#about .right{width:730px; overflow:hidden; float:right;}
#about .right span{display:block; width:100%; height:48px; background:url(../images/ico.png) left center no-repeat;}
#about .right strong{display:block;float: left;padding-left: 30px;height: 48px;line-height:70px;font-size:24px;color:#e70d0c;font-weight:normal;}
#about .right b{display:block;float: left;padding-left:10px;height: 48px;line-height:75px;font-size: 24px;color: #999;font-weight:normal; font-family:Arial;}
#about .right p{display:block; width:100%; font-size:14px; color:#444;text-align:justify;text-justify:inter-ideograph; margin-top:20px; line-height:25px;}

/*产品中心*/
#product{overflow:hidden;width:100%;min-width:1140px;min-height:670px;background-color:#f8f8f8;}
.product{width:1140px;margin:auto;overflow:hidden;}
.product ul{width:1160px; position:relative}
.product ul li{float:left;overflow:hidden;margin-right:20px;margin-bottom:20px;width:270px;transition:all .5s linear;}
.product ul li:hover{-webkit-box-shadow:0 15px 30px rgba(0,0,0,.1);-moz-box-shadow:0 15px 30px rgba(0,0,0,.1);-ms-box-shadow:0 15px 30px rgba(0,0,0,.1);transform:translate3d(0,-8px,0);box-shadow:0 15px 30px rgba(0,0,0,.1)}
.product ul li img{display:block;padding:2px;width:264px;height:175px;border:1px solid #ccc;}
.product ul li span{display:block; width:100%; line-height:30px; text-align:center;}

/*主营业务*/
.yewu{width:1140px;overflow:hidden;margin:auto;}
.yewu ul {position:relative; width:1200px;}
.yewu ul li{width:570px; overflow:hidden; float:left; margin-bottom:30px;}
.yewu ul li img{width:190px; height:140px; display:block; float:left; margin-right:15px;}
.yewu ul li strong{display:block; overflow:hidden; font-size:16px; color:#333; padding-bottom:8px;}
.yewu ul li p{display:block; overflow:hidden; font-size:12px; color:#666;text-align:justify;text-justify:inter-ideograph;font-family:宋体;height:80px;width:340px; line-height:22px;}
.yewu ul li span{display:block;overflow:hidden;/*padding:5px 8px 5px 8px;*/background-color:#eee;width:78px;height:28px;text-align:center;line-height:28px; border-radius:3px;}
.yewu ul li a:hover span{background-color:#019944;color:#fff;}

/*客户案例*/
.case{overflow:hidden;margin:auto;width:1140px;}
.case_bt{overflow:hidden;margin-top:40px;margin-bottom:30px;width:100%;}
.case_bt .left{float:left;overflow:hidden;height:45px;}
.case_bt .left strong{position:absolute;display:block;color:#000;font-size:24px;}
.case_bt .left span{position:relative;top:38px;display:block;width:80px;height:4px;border-radius:2px;background-color:#019944;}
.case_bt .right{float:right;overflow:hidden;width:90px;}
.case_bt .right span{float:left;display:block;overflow:hidden;width:40px;height:40px;border-radius:3px;background-color:#019944;color:#fff;text-align:center;font-weight:700;font-size:15px;font-family:宋体;line-height:40px;}
.case_bt .right span:hover{background-color:#666;cursor:pointer;}
.case_bt .right .prev{float:right;}

.logos{width:1140px;overflow:hidden;}
.logos ul{width:1140px; position:relative;}
.logos ul li{float:left;overflow:hidden;margin-right:0px;margin-bottom:50px;width:290px;}
.logos ul li img{display:block;padding:2px;width:264px;height:175px;border:1px solid #ddd;}
.logos ul li span{display:block; font-size:13px; text-align:center; padding-top:8px; color:#333}

#liuyan{width:100%; height:250px;background-color:#ccc; min-width:1140px;}
.liuyan{width:1000px; height:250px; overflow:hidden;margin:auto;}
.liuyan .left{width:265px; overflow:hidden; float:left; text-align:right;}
.liuyan .left strong{display:block; overflow:hidden; font-size:24px; color:#333; margin-bottom:20px; margin-top:60px;}
.liuyan .left p{display:block; overflow:hidden; font-size:15px; color:#333; line-height:22px;}
.liuyan .right{width:700px; overflow:hidden; float:right;}
.liuyan .right span{display:block; overflow:hidden; font-size:15px; color:#666;margin-top:60px; margin-bottom:10px;}
.liuyan .right .text1{display:block; width:320px; overflow:hidden; height:40px; float:left;border-radius:3px; border:1px solid #ccc; padding-left:15px; font-size:14px;}
.liuyan .right .text2{display:block; width:200px; overflow:hidden; height:40px; float:left;border-radius:3px; border:1px solid #ccc;font-size:14px; margin-top:10px;transition:all .5s linear; cursor:pointer;}
.liuyan .right .text2:hover{background-color:#009a44; color:#fff;}



/*新闻资讯*/
#jmf_bt{width:100%;min-width:1140px;overflow:hidden;height:155px;overflow:hidden;background:url(../images/liso_bt.png) center 105px no-repeat;}
#jmf_bt span{display:block;width:100%;color:#404040;font-size:26px;text-align:center;margin-top:38px;}
#jmf_bt p{display:block;width:100%;overflow:hidden;text-align:center;font-size:14px;color:#898888;line-height:32px;}
#news .left{float:left}
#news .right{float:right}
#news{width:1140px;margin:0 auto;clear:both}
.research-top .left{padding-top:0px}
.research-top .right{padding-top:0px}
.research-top .right li{padding:8px 20px;float:left}

.research-top .right li.active,.research-top .right li:hover{border-bottom:2px solid #189c4a}
.research-top .right li a{font-size:18px;color:#212121}
.research-top .right li.active a,.research-top .right li:hover a{color:#189c4a;cursor:pointer}
.top-fixed-nav-yjy{background:#fff;width:100%;height:90px;position:fixed;top:0;z-index:100001;box-shadow:0 0 20px rgba(0,0,0,.2);display:none}

.index-module-header{height:43px;line-height:43px;overflow:hidden; margin-bottom:10px}
.index-module-header h2{float:left;font-size:24px;color:#000000}
.index-module-header a.check-more{float:right;color:#212121;}
.index-module-header a.check-more:hover{color:#f90}

.header-top-right-nav{float:right;font-size:14px; text-align:right;}
.index-module-header .header-top-right-nav a.more{color:#000;font-size:14px;margin-left:-10px;}
.index-module-header .header-top-right-nav a.more{display:block;width:74px;height:34px;line-height:25px; float:right;}
.index-module-header .header-top-right-nav a.more:hover{color:#000;}
.index-module-header .header-top-right-nav a.txzs-type{color:#000;font-size:14px;/*padding:3px 16px*/width:74px;height:34px;line-height:25px; display:block; float:left; text-align:center; margin-left:20px;}
.index-module-header .header-top-right-nav a.current{/*background:#8c8787;border-radius:4px;*/color:#fff;background:url(../images/ico_news.png);width:74px;height:34px;line-height:25px; text-align:center;font-size:14px;}

.exhibitor{margin-top:0px;margin-bottom:50px;overflow:hidden}
.exhibitor .left{width:485px;height:380px;float:left}
.exhibitor .center{float:left;width:615px;height:350px;background:#fff; float:right;}
.exhibitor .center li{width:100%;height:95px;padding-left:10px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;position:relative;padding-left:130px}
.exhibitor .center li .txzs-news-logo{position:absolute;width:120px;height:75px;left:0;top:0}
.exhibitor .center li h2{padding:0px 0;font-size:14px;color:#000;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}
.exhibitor .center li p{width:100%;overflow:hidden;line-height:18px;color:#757575;font-size:12px}
.exhibitor .center li:hover h2{color:#F00}
.exhibitor .center ul{display:none}

.txzs-slidebox{width:485px;height:380px;overflow:hidden;position:relative;float:left;margin-bottom:20px}
.txzs-slidebox .hd{height:10px;overflow:hidden;position:absolute;left:50%;bottom:30px;z-index:1;margin-left:-25px}
.txzs-slidebox .hd ul{overflow:hidden;zoom:1;float:left}
.txzs-slidebox .hd ul li{text-align:center;width:10px;height:10px;display:inline-block;margin-right:7px;cursor:pointer;-webkit-border-radius:50%;-moz-border-radius:50%;border-radius:50%;background-color:#bcbcbc;text-indent:99px;opacity:.7}
.txzs-slidebox .hd ul li.on{background:#5a5a5a}
.txzs-slidebox .bd{position:relative;height:100%;z-index:0}
.txzs-slidebox .bd li{zoom:1;vertical-align:middle;position:relative;width:485px;height:380px}
.txzs-slidebox .bd li .txzs-desc{position:absolute;background:#fff;width:485px;height:150px;left:0;bottom:0}
.txzs-slidebox .bd img{width:485px;height:230px;display:block}
.txzs-slidebox .txzs-intro,.txzs-slidebox .txzs-title{padding:12px 0 0 0px}
.txzs-slidebox .txzs-intro{font-size:12px;color:#8c8787;line-height:20px;text-align:justify;text-justify:inter-ideograph;}
.txzs-slidebox .txzs-title a{font-size:16px;color:#000}
.txzs-slidebox .txzs-title a:hover{color:#f00;cursor:pointer}
/*.txzs-slidebox .txzs-title span{display:inline-block;padding:3px 13px;background:#00a33e;font-size:12px;color:#fff;border-radius:3px;position:relative;margin-right:10px}
.txzs-slidebox .txzs-title span:after{content:"";position:absolute;right:-3px;top:50%;width:0;height:0;margin-top:-5px;border-top:5px solid transparent;border-left:5px solid #00a33e;border-bottom:5px solid transparent}*/.txzs-slidebox .txzs-title span{display:inline-block;font-size:12px;color:#fff;position:relative;margin-right:10px; width:35px; height:31px; text-align:center; line-height:23px; background-image:url(../images/ico_tj.png)}
/*首页新闻结束*/










